olfaktív
Olfaktív is an adjective used to describe anything related to the sense of smell or the olfactory system. In medical and scientific literature, it is used to refer to olfactory receptors, the olfactory epithelium, the olfactory bulb, and neural pathways involved in odor detection and processing. The term derives from Latin olfactus “smell” through French olfactif and English olfactory, with cognate forms in various languages that use suffixes such as -ív or -if to form adjectives.

Olfaktív function can be affected by infection, trauma, chronic rhinosinusitis, exposure to toxins, or neurodegenerative diseases.
